博文纲领:
- 1、零基础怎样写代码?
- 2、如何自学编程
- 3、初学者学习python编程有哪些方法?
- 4、新手如何学习编程?
零基础怎样写代码?
零基础的人想要写代码首先需要进行一定的学习,了解一些基础的编程知识,选择适合自己的程序语言,之后通过不断的学习就可以写代码。从简单的、直接的伯几行十几行程序开始,比如计算器;到复杂的小工具,比如大数计算器。
配置电脑编程环境:大家准备好电脑之后,为了编程,我们首先要配置好电脑的编译环境。这样为我们接下来的学习和动手实践会带来方便,现在主流的编程语言是Java语言,这里建议大家把Java学习作为基础语言。
不断练习和实践,通过不断地写代码来提高自己的编程能力。保持好奇心和学习热情,持续关注新技术和发展趋势,不断提升自己的技术水平。
如何自学编程
1、自学编程的方法主要包括以下几点:以书籍为基础:选择质量上乘的书籍:实体书籍能为你提供系统的知识和清晰的解释,有助于构建对编程的整体认知。弥补网络资源的不足:虽然网络资源丰富,但书籍往往能提供更深入、更系统的内容,帮助你解决基础知识上的疑问。
2、自学编程的方法如下:制定合理的学习计划:要给自己安排一个合理的学习时间,建议每天投入两个到五个小时的时间来学习编程,确保学习的持续性和系统性。利用网络资源:可以从网上找一些视频教程来自学。现在网上的编程教程非常丰富且成体系,能够满足不同学习阶段的需求。
3、动手实践:通过完成一些小项目来实践编程技能,如编写简单的网页、游戏等。 参与开源项目:加入开源项目可以学习到更多编程技巧和经验,同时也能锻炼团队协作能力。 不断挑战自己:尝试解决复杂问题,不断挑战自己的技能边界。
4、一定要给自己安排一个合理的学习计划,每天拿出两个到五个小时的时间来学习编程。可以从网上找一些视频教程来自学,现在网上的教程非常多,而且都是成套的。可以自己去自学网站上找,在学习视频教程的同时,一定要跟着老师练习。每学会了一些新的技能,一定要自己动手去尝试编程。
5、自学编程实现程序员“速成”的方法主要包括以下几点:选择合适的学习路径:明确目标:确定你想要学习的特定技术领域,并明确在这一领域内胜任所需的知识与技能集合。选择速成课程:可以选择一些经过验证的高质量速成课程,这些课程通常能在几个月内高强度地教授所需的基本技能。
6、入门期守一个“熬”字决 自学编程难免遇到这种现象:学了一两个月,发现自己会的不多。编程在一开始不会有那么大的反馈,这种现象非常正常!关键是你要坚持个三个月到半年的时间,熬过这个艰难的入门期。
初学者学习python编程有哪些方法?
:0023:00学习和写作时间。23:00以后刷刷百度等,12点前睡觉,保证晚上至少有6个小时高质量睡眠时间。当然了,具体的时间安排可以灵活调整,最重要的是要有一种自制力,娱乐要有度。多做题 这一点就不用多说了吧,要想学好编程没有捷径。
函数调用的方法 库的安装和使用 编程,其实就是利用特定的语言控制计算机,或者说和计算机进行交流。对于python零基础作为初学者,要掌握以下基础知识就算入门了。编程环境的安装与使用。比如Python的学习一般推荐软件自带的IDLE,简单好用。掌握输入、输入语句的使用。
首先第一点,要能够看懂了解变量、基础语法、编程规范等,这些事能够上手编写Python 代码的前提。其次第二点,对于数据结构,字符串、列表、字典等需要比较熟练运用。刚开始的这部分就做一些简单的练习,构造出一个数据类型,然后再实现基本的用法。
第三阶段数据分析+人工智能。这部分主要是学习爬虫相关的知识点,你需要掌握数据抓取、数据提取、数据存储、爬虫并发、动态网页抓取、scrapy框架、分布式爬虫、爬虫攻防、数据结构、算法等知识。第四阶段高级进阶。
新手如何学习编程?
实践编程:学习编程最好的方法就是动手实践。从简单的程序开始,如打印输出、计算器等,逐渐挑战更复杂的项目。 参加在线课程或编程社区:参加一些在线课程或加入编程社区,与其他学习者交流,分享经验,解决问题。 保持持续学习:编程是一个不断学习和进步的过程。
新手学习编程入门,可以从以下几个方面着手: 选择平台 桌面平台:根据操作系统选择,如Windows、Linux或Mac。Windows平台适合初学者,因其用户广泛且编程框架多样;Linux适合对开源和服务器有兴趣的学习者;Mac则适合苹果设备开发者。 移动平台:如果对移动应用开发感兴趣,可以选择Android或iOS平台。
多实践多敲代码,理论知识固然重要,但实践更为关键。在学习过程中,要多动手写代码,遇到不懂的地方,可以类比日常生活中的事物来帮助理解。例如,在学习数据结构时,可以通过想象餐厅排队叫号系统来理解队列的概念。学会记笔记,学习编程时,记笔记是必不可少的。
如果你是编程新手,我推荐学习.NET框架,特别是C#,这是一个非常实用的选择。另外,JAVA也是非常流行的语言,尤其是在Web开发领域。尽管JAVA在Web开发上很有潜力,但这一领域确实具有一定的挑战性。学习编程时,数据库知识是不可或缺的。